Optometrist Hourly Pay in DeSoto, TX: $64.73 (2026)
Quick Answer:Hourly pay for a optometrist working in DeSoto, TX runs $64.73 at the median for 2026 — annualizing to $134,638 at a standard 2,080-hour year. Figures proj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-1041). Weighted against DeSoto's regional price level (BEA RPP 96.0, 4% below national), each hour of work buys what $67.43 nationally would. A 24-hour part-time schedule grosses $80,784 per year.
Based on BLS state-level estimates · View source

In 2026, the median hourly pay for optometrists in DeSoto, TX, is projected to be $64.73. This hourly rate is slightly below the national median of $67.60, suggesting that while local opportunities are competitive, they might not fully reflect the potential earnings available elsewhere in the United States. For part-time optometrists, specifically those working three days a week, this hourly rate can provide a stable income, amounting to approximately $82,000 annually before taxes. The range in hourly earnings spans from $37.54 for entry-level positions to about $99.01 for top-tier optometrists. Settings of employment may vary widely, including private exam rooms, retail optical chains, and even hospital systems, all of which can influence the hourly wage significantly.

Working as an Hourly Optometrist in DeSoto
When considering part-time work, an optometrist who joins the workforce for just 24 hours a week can expect different financial outcomes than their full-time counterparts. Engaging in per diem work is also quite lucrative; optometrists may command daily rates between $500 and $1,200 depending on the nature of their practice and the complexity of procedures offered. For instance, fill-in roles at retail chains often yield $500 to $800, while specialized roles may pay over $700 daily. The type of practice significantly impacts hourly pay; private practices might offer lower hourly compensation but include benefits like health insurance, while retail chains provide higher rates without benefits. Negotiating these terms in DeSoto effectively can hinge on understanding local market conditions and salary expectations based on employer type, ensuring that optometrists align their compensation with their professional objectives.
